WebThe UroCuff Test measures the amount of pressure generated by your bladder, your urine flow rate and amount of urine that you void. A small cuff is fitted to penis. Patient begins to void into a flow meter. The cuff inflates until flow is reduced or interrupted. Cuff rapidly deflates, allowing flow to resume. WebAug 23, 2024 · These rotator cuff muscles are commonly injured or affected. In order to diagnose which rotator cuff muscles is affected by the injury or pathology, each muscle has to be isolated and tested. The best test for examination of the supraspinatus muscle is the Jobes Test or the Empty Can Test (Figure 2). As a matter of fact, in all tests, a significant increase in strength was recorded when the test was performed with a cuff around the … WebDec 3, 2024 · Diagnosing a Rotator Cuff Tear: Summary. So to review, I recommend the following tests for a rotator cuff tear: Empty Can Test. Drop Arm Test. Lag Sign. Infraspinatus Test. Lift-Off Test. If you conclude from these tests that you have a torn rotator cuff, be sure to follow up with your doctor or physical therapist.
